    Process chillers are among the hardest working refrigeration

    systems built. Most plants rely on exact temperature fluids

    to control manufacturing processes. Industrial process

    cooling loads are severely cyclic, ranging from 0% to 100%.

    Hot gas bypass has been traditionally used to vary the load

    on the system evaporator. Today Emerson Climate

    Technologies offers more efficient modulation alternatives

    to hot gas bypass - Copeland Scroll Digital and Copeland

    Scroll UltraTech compressors.

    Modulation options highlights

    Copeland Scroll Digital compressors

    Capacity range from 10 to 100%

    Reduced power consumption up to 30% more effi-

    cient than using hot gas bypass

    Longer cycle times to reduce wear and improve hu-

    midity control

    Simple, variable modulation, for precise temperature

    control within 0.50F

    Copeland Scroll UltraTech compressors

    Two-step scroll capacity (67%, 100%)
